一:介绍

1.官网

  官网:http://gethue.com/

    

  下载:http://archive.cloudera.com/cdh5/cdh/5/,只能在这里下载,不是Apache的

  手册:http://archive.cloudera.com/cdh5/cdh/5/hue-3.7.0-cdh5.3.6/manual.html

  

2.支持的框架

  -》job

    -》yarn
    -》mr1
  -》oozie
  -》HDFS
    -》查文件
    -》文件的管理
    -》增删改查
  -》hive
  -》rdbms

  截图:

  

3.注意

  hue必须重新编译,因为对于每个linux环境不同。

二:安装

1.下载hue包

  

2.需要安装的依赖

  

3.检测依赖

  

4.安装依赖包

  sudo yum install ant asciidoc cyrus-sasl-devel  libtidy   libxml2-devel  libxslt-devel mvn mysql-devel openldap-devel python-devel sqlite-devel -y

5.卸载openjdk

  

6.编译

  进入家目录,make apps

  

7.配置hue.int

  路径是:desktop/conf

  所有的配置都是以中括号进行标记。

  

8.启动

  

9.访问web ui

  http://linux-hadoop3.ibeifeng.com:8888/

10.创建hue的root用户

  建议使用HDFS的账户,以后可以跳过权限检查。

  

11.进入主界面

  

三:hue与其他框架的集成

四:与HDFS的集成(修改hadoop和hue的配置)

1.修改hdfs-site

  

2.修改core-site的代理

  

3.重启hdfs

  

4.配置hue中的hdfs

  

5.重启hue

  

6.效果

  

五:配置yarn

1.只需要配置hue.ini

  

2.重启hue

  

3.检测效果

  

六:hive的集成

1.hive的三种链接方式

  比较重要的一种是远程链接metastore

2.远程链接metastore

  配置hive-site

  

  但是,每次配置了这个,都需要在开启hive之前开启服务

    bin/hive --service metastore &

3.集成hive

4.hive只需要开启hiveserver2

  

  

5.在hive-site中可以修改的项

  在hive的默认端口是10000,协议是tcp。但是可以修改为http,同时修改对应的端口是10001.

    <property>

      <name>hive.server2.transport.mode</name>
      <value>http</value>
      <description>Server transport mode. "binary" or "http".</description>
    </property>

  

  在链接hiveserver中,有时出现链接超时,可以修改一下的配置,可以避免这种情况。

    <property>

      <name>hive.server2.long.polling.timeout</name>
      <value>5000</value>
      <description>Time in milliseconds that HiveServer2 will wait, before responding to asynchronous calls that use long polling</description>
    </property>

6.开启hiveserver2

  bin/hiveserver2

7.修改hue.ini

  

8.重启hue

9.检测效果

  

七:集成RDMS

1.配置sqlite

  启动标记对。

  数据库显示名称,数据库的位置,引擎

  

2.查看效果

  

3.配置mysql

  数据库的位置不给,说明加载所有的数据库。

  

4.启动hue

  

5.查看效果

  

八:与oozie的集成

1.修改oozie的文件

  原本是${user.name},现在改成oozie。

  

2.重新创建share lib

  bin/oozie-setup.sh sharelib create -fs hdfs://linux-hadoop3.ibeifeng.com:8020 -locallib oozie-sharelib-4.0.0-cdh5.3.6-yarn.tar.gz

  

3.启动oozie

4.修改hue下 的oozie配置

  

5.重启

6.查看效果

  

  

 

069 Hue协作框架的更多相关文章

  1. Hue协作框架

    http://archive.cloudera.com/cdh5/cdh/5/hue-3.7.0-cdh5.3.6/manual.html 一:框架 1.支持的框架 ->job ->yar ...

  2. Oozie协作框架

    一:概述 1.大数据协作框架 2.Hadoop的任务调度 3.Oozie的三大功能 Oozie Workflow jobs Oozie Coordinator jobs Oozie Bundle 4. ...

  3. 067 Flume协作框架

    一:介绍 1.概述 ->flume的三大功能 collecting, aggregating, and moving 收集 聚合 移动 数据源:web service              ...

  4. Flume协作框架

    1.概述 ->flume的三大功能 collecting, aggregating, and moving 收集 聚合 移动 2.框图 3.架构特点 ->on streaming data ...

  5. 【Hadoop 分布式部署 八:分布式协作框架Zookeeper架构功能讲解 及本地模式安装部署和命令使用 】

    What  is  Zookeeper 是一个开源的分布式的,为分布式应用提供协作服务的Apache项目 提供一个简单的原语集合,以便与分布式应用可以在他之上构建更高层次的同步服务 设计非常简单易于编 ...

  6. 【Hadoop 分布式部署 九:分布式协作框架Zookeeper架构 分布式安装部署 】

    1.首先将运行在本地上的  zookeeper 给停止掉 2.到/opt/softwares 目录下  将  zookeeper解压到  /opt/app 目录下 命令:  tar -zxvf zoo ...

  7. Hadoop调度框架

        大数据协作框架是一个桐城,就是Hadoop2生态系统中几个辅助的Hadoop2.x框架.主要如下: 1,数据转换工具Sqoop 2,文件搜集框架Flume 3,任务调度框架Oozie 4,大数 ...

  8. Sqoop框架基础

    Sqoop框架基础 本节我们主要需要了解的是大数据的一些协作框架,也是属于Hadoop生态系统或周边的内容,比如: ** 数据转换工具:Sqoop ** 文件收集库框架:Flume ** 任务调度框架 ...

  9. 068 Oozie任务调度框架

    一:概述 1.大数据协作框架 2.Hadoop的任务调度 这个是常见的任务调度框架. 3.azkaban 4..Oozie的三大功能 Oozie Workflow jobs :工作流任务,可以生成DA ...

随机推荐

  1. beef框架使用

    http://resources.infosecinstitute.com/beef-part-2/ http://resources.infosecinstitute.com/beef-part-1 ...

  2. leetCode- 472. Concatenated Words

    因为每个组合的字符串,至少要有3个index. 起点,中间拼接点,结点.所以可以将字符串分解为子字符串,判断子字符串是否存在.但是,后面字符串的存在必须要在前面字符串已经存在基础上判断. class ...

  3. VC++中LogFont设置字体(转)

    LOGFONT是Windows内部字体的逻辑结构,主要用于设置字体格式,其定义如下:typedef struct tagLOGFONTA{LONG lfHeight;LONG lfWidth;LONG ...

  4. asp.net EF框架执行原生SQL语句

    1.执行无参数sql: string sql = "select * from IntegralInfo where convert(nvarchar,getdate(),23)='{0}' ...

  5. text-decoration和text-indent和text-shadow

    text-decoration 属性规定添加到文本的修饰,规定划线的位置. <html> <head> <style type="text/css"& ...

  6. 使用flask_socketio实现服务端向客户端定时推送

    websocket连接是客户端与服务器之间永久的双向通信通道,直到某方断开连接. 双向通道意味着在连接时,服务端随时可以发送消息给客户端,反之亦然,这在一些需要即时通讯的场景比如多人聊天室非常重要. ...

  7. 下拉框combobox用法&级联餐单

    如果下来内容不用后台取数据,直接写死的话不用url属性,直接用data即可: <input id="orderstate" name="orderstate&quo ...

  8. Django开发笔记三

    Django开发笔记一 Django开发笔记二 Django开发笔记三 Django开发笔记四 Django开发笔记五 Django开发笔记六 1.基于类的方式重写登录:views.py: from ...

  9. Linux的7个运行级别

    0:关机 1:单用户(找回丢失密码)此模式下所有用户不需要密码即可登录,可用于重置密码 2:多用户状态没有网络服务 3:多用户状态有网络服务 ★ 4:系统未使用保留给用户 5:图形界面 ★ 6:系统重 ...

  10. 【转】Python之函数进阶

    [转]Python之函数进阶 本节内容 上一篇中介绍了Python中函数的定义.函数的调用.函数的参数以及变量的作用域等内容,现在来说下函数的一些高级特性: 递归函数 嵌套函数与闭包 匿名函数 高阶函 ...